Abstract
The invention relates to a cambered-surface cam machining tool, which is provided with a rack, wherein the extension part of the rack is provided with a base of a spindle box; the spindle box capable of being adjusted movably is arranged on the base of the spindle box; a machine tool spindle is arranged on the spindle box; a workpiece rotary table is arranged on the rack and is provided with a workpiece support; a workpiece to be machined is arranged on the workpiece support; the workpiece support drives the workpiece to rotate around a horizontal shaft; the rotating face of the workpiece is a vertical face; the workpiece rotary table is provided with two parallel guide rails which are respectively a workpiece support guide rail provided with the workpiece support and an ejector pin support guide rail provided with an ejector pin support; the ejector pin support can be slipped on the ejector pin support guide rail; the workpiece support and the ejector pin support are respectively provided with a locking mechanism; the workpiece support is provided with a central spindle; the ejector pin support is internally provided with an ejector pin, and the ejector pin and a distensible shaft are moved front and back on the same axis; and the workpiece fixed on the distensible shaft is ejected. The workpiece can be moved along the two parallel guide rails arranged on the workpiece rotary table so as to be used for adjusting a center distance of a cambered-surface cam mechanism.

Background technology
The cam cutter-exchange mechanism is one of key feature in the Digit Control Machine Tool, and globoid cam is the core part of cutter-exchange mechanism, and the crudy of cam has directly determined the performance of cutter-exchange mechanism.Because the complexity of globoid cam structure, machine tool can't be accomplished processing.Current domestic a kind of method is that machine tool transform the special machine bed as, and this lathe can only be accomplished the moulding of globoid cam, be difficult to carry out grinding, so machining accuracy is lower; Another kind method is five number of coordinates controlled grinders from external introduction, but this lathe rigidity is relatively poor, and the pivot angle of rolling movement is limited, and grinding accuracy is not high, has also satisfied not the demand of market to high-grade globoid cam.The high-grade cutter-exchange mechanism of domestic demands relies on from countries and regions imports such as Japan, Taiwan basically, has seriously restricted the development of China's high-grade, digitally controlled machine tools.
